YADGIR: A mother and her son were brutally attacked by a group of people from another community at Putpak village in the district for posting a photo of a saffron flag on social media.

The incident happened when a group of Shivamala devotees were conducting a religious function in the village and had put up saffron flags. A young man from the village had posted a photo of the flags on social media, which was misinterpreted by a group of people from another community.

Villagers staged a protest demanding action against the attackers.

A group of seven Muslim youths went to the young man’s house and attacked him and his mother, Nagamma, when she questioned their actions. The attack has sparked outrage in the village, with locals protesting and demanding action against the perpetrators.

The protesters, carrying images of Shiva, Parvati, and Dr B R Ambedkar, demanded that the attackers apologize and be arrested. The police have registered a case against the 7 Muslim youths involved in the attack.
